Desert Support Services Pty Ltd (DSS) delivers a range of services in remote Western Australia, primarily in Indigenous land management and community development. For more than 10 years, these services have supported Aboriginal people to achieve sustainable and independent futures by empowering local and regional decision making. DSS is a fast paced, values driven organisation doing rewarding and highly valued work for its clients.
The Administration Support Officer works across DSS programs providing administrative and logistics support to staff implementing programs in community, and in Perth in the newly purpose built ‘Desert Hub’. DSS programs are dynamic and adaptive to change. Supporting field staff to implement programs with Traditional Owners is crucial to the DSS mission.
